Grimsby Trolls Amorim After Historic Cup Upset

In a dramatic turn of events, Manchester United found themselves on the wrong end of a League Cup upset, eliminated by Grimsby Town in a nail-biting penalty shootout that ended 12-11 following a 2-2 draw.

The fourth-tier English club is now relishing its historic victory, and they’re not shy about letting everyone know it!

This Saturday, Grimsby Town took to social media, poking fun at United’s head coach Ruben Amorim. They shared a cheeky video parodying a moment where Amorim was seen moving tactical pieces on the board, trying to find a solution for his struggling team.

As the clip played, Grimsby announced their lineup against Bristol Rovers, hilariously mimicking Amorim’s tactical gestures to highlight their four changes.

Grimsby’s Humorous Take on a Historic Upset

While Grimsby Town is enjoying their time in the spotlight, the pressure is mounting for Amorim at Old Trafford. After a disappointing defeat to Arsenal and a draw with Fulham, Manchester United is facing Burnley this Saturday with fans demanding a decisive result. The stakes couldn’t be higher for the beleaguered coach, who is under scrutiny to turn the fortunes of the struggling club around.

In a candid moment during a press conference, Amorim expressed the turmoil he is feeling, stating, ‘Sometimes I want to resign, and sometimes I want to stay for twenty years.’ The humiliation of being knocked out by a fourth-division club might weigh heavily on his future at the club, leading to questions about whether he can survive this rough patch.
